/external/libcxx/test/numerics/complex.number/complex.transcendentals/ |
acosh.pass.cpp | 43 if (x[i].real() == 0 && x[i].imag() == 0) 46 if (std::signbit(x[i].imag())) 47 is_about(r.imag(), -pi/2); 49 is_about(r.imag(), pi/2); 51 else if (x[i].real() == 1 && x[i].imag() == 0) 55 assert(r.imag() == 0); 56 assert(std::signbit(r.imag()) == std::signbit(x[i].imag())); 58 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) 62 if (std::signbit(x[i].imag())) [all...] |
log.pass.cpp | 42 if (x[i].real() == 0 && x[i].imag() == 0) 48 if (std::signbit(x[i].imag())) 49 is_about(r.imag(), -pi); 51 is_about(r.imag(), pi); 57 assert(r.imag() == 0); 58 assert(std::signbit(x[i].imag()) == std::signbit(r.imag())); 61 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) 65 if (x[i].imag() > 0) 66 is_about(r.imag(), pi/2) [all...] |
acos.pass.cpp | 43 if (x[i].real() == 0 && x[i].imag() == 0) 46 assert(r.imag() == 0); 47 assert(std::signbit(x[i].imag()) != std::signbit(r.imag())); 49 else if (x[i].real() == 0 && std::isnan(x[i].imag())) 52 assert(std::isnan(r.imag())); 54 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) 57 assert(std::isinf(r.imag())); 58 assert(std::signbit(x[i].imag()) != std::signbit(r.imag())); [all...] |
atanh.pass.cpp | 43 if (x[i].real() == 0 && x[i].imag() == 0) 46 assert(std::signbit(r.imag()) == std::signbit(x[i].imag())); 48 else if ( x[i].real() == 0 && std::isnan(x[i].imag())) 52 assert(std::isnan(r.imag())); 54 else if (std::abs(x[i].real()) == 1 && x[i].imag() == 0) 58 assert(r.imag() == 0); 59 assert(std::signbit(x[i].imag()) == std::signbit(r.imag())); 61 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) [all...] |
sinh.pass.cpp | 43 if (x[i].real() == 0 && x[i].imag() == 0) 47 assert(r.imag() == 0); 48 assert(std::signbit(r.imag()) == std::signbit(x[i].imag())); 50 else if (x[i].real() == 0 && std::isinf(x[i].imag())) 53 assert(std::isnan(r.imag())); 55 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) 58 assert(std::isnan(r.imag())); 60 else if (x[i].real() == 0 && std::isnan(x[i].imag())) 63 assert(std::isnan(r.imag())); [all...] |
asin.pass.cpp | 43 if (x[i].real() == 0 && x[i].imag() == 0) 46 assert(std::signbit(r.imag()) == std::signbit(x[i].imag())); 48 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) 52 assert(std::isinf(r.imag())); 53 assert(std::signbit(x[i].imag()) == std::signbit(r.imag())); 55 else if ( x[i].real() == 0 && std::isnan(x[i].imag())) 59 assert(std::isnan(r.imag())); 61 else if (std::isfinite(x[i].real()) && std::isnan(x[i].imag())) [all...] |
exp.pass.cpp | 41 if (x[i].real() == 0 && x[i].imag() == 0) 44 assert(r.imag() == 0); 45 assert(std::signbit(x[i].imag()) == std::signbit(r.imag())); 47 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) 50 assert(std::isnan(r.imag())); 52 else if (std::isfinite(x[i].real()) && std::isnan(x[i].imag())) 55 assert(std::isnan(r.imag())); 57 else if (std::isinf(x[i].real()) && x[i].real() > 0 && x[i].imag() == 0) 61 assert(r.imag() == 0) [all...] |
asinh.pass.cpp | 43 if (x[i].real() == 0 && x[i].imag() == 0) 46 assert(std::signbit(r.imag()) == std::signbit(x[i].imag())); 48 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) 52 if (std::signbit(x[i].imag())) 53 is_about(r.imag(), -pi/2); 55 is_about(r.imag(), pi/2); 57 else if (std::isfinite(x[i].real()) && std::isnan(x[i].imag())) 60 assert(std::isnan(r.imag())); 62 else if (std::isinf(x[i].real()) && std::isfinite(x[i].imag())) [all...] |
cosh.pass.cpp | 43 if (x[i].real() == 0 && x[i].imag() == 0) 46 assert(r.imag() == 0); 47 assert(std::signbit(r.imag()) == std::signbit(x[i].imag())); 49 else if (x[i].real() == 0 && std::isinf(x[i].imag())) 52 assert(r.imag() == 0); 54 else if (x[i].real() == 0 && std::isnan(x[i].imag())) 57 assert(r.imag() == 0); 59 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) 62 assert(std::isnan(r.imag())); [all...] |
sqrt.pass.cpp | 27 assert(std::abs(imag(c)) < 1.e-6); 43 if (x[i].real() == 0 && x[i].imag() == 0) 46 assert(std::signbit(r.imag()) == std::signbit(x[i].imag())); 48 else if (std::isinf(x[i].imag())) 52 assert(std::isinf(r.imag())); 53 assert(std::signbit(r.imag()) == std::signbit(x[i].imag())); 55 else if (std::isfinite(x[i].real()) && std::isnan(x[i].imag())) 58 assert(std::isnan(r.imag())); [all...] |
/ndk/sources/cxx-stl/llvm-libc++/libcxx/test/numerics/complex.number/complex.transcendentals/ |
acosh.pass.cpp | 43 if (x[i].real() == 0 && x[i].imag() == 0) 46 if (std::signbit(x[i].imag())) 47 is_about(r.imag(), -pi/2); 49 is_about(r.imag(), pi/2); 51 else if (x[i].real() == 1 && x[i].imag() == 0) 55 assert(r.imag() == 0); 56 assert(std::signbit(r.imag()) == std::signbit(x[i].imag())); 58 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) 62 if (std::signbit(x[i].imag())) [all...] |
log.pass.cpp | 42 if (x[i].real() == 0 && x[i].imag() == 0) 48 if (std::signbit(x[i].imag())) 49 is_about(r.imag(), -pi); 51 is_about(r.imag(), pi); 57 assert(r.imag() == 0); 58 assert(std::signbit(x[i].imag()) == std::signbit(r.imag())); 61 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) 65 if (x[i].imag() > 0) 66 is_about(r.imag(), pi/2) [all...] |
acos.pass.cpp | 43 if (x[i].real() == 0 && x[i].imag() == 0) 46 assert(r.imag() == 0); 47 assert(std::signbit(x[i].imag()) != std::signbit(r.imag())); 49 else if (x[i].real() == 0 && std::isnan(x[i].imag())) 52 assert(std::isnan(r.imag())); 54 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) 57 assert(std::isinf(r.imag())); 58 assert(std::signbit(x[i].imag()) != std::signbit(r.imag())); [all...] |
atanh.pass.cpp | 43 if (x[i].real() == 0 && x[i].imag() == 0) 46 assert(std::signbit(r.imag()) == std::signbit(x[i].imag())); 48 else if ( x[i].real() == 0 && std::isnan(x[i].imag())) 52 assert(std::isnan(r.imag())); 54 else if (std::abs(x[i].real()) == 1 && x[i].imag() == 0) 58 assert(r.imag() == 0); 59 assert(std::signbit(x[i].imag()) == std::signbit(r.imag())); 61 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) [all...] |
sinh.pass.cpp | 43 if (x[i].real() == 0 && x[i].imag() == 0) 47 assert(r.imag() == 0); 48 assert(std::signbit(r.imag()) == std::signbit(x[i].imag())); 50 else if (x[i].real() == 0 && std::isinf(x[i].imag())) 53 assert(std::isnan(r.imag())); 55 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) 58 assert(std::isnan(r.imag())); 60 else if (x[i].real() == 0 && std::isnan(x[i].imag())) 63 assert(std::isnan(r.imag())); [all...] |
asin.pass.cpp | 43 if (x[i].real() == 0 && x[i].imag() == 0) 46 assert(std::signbit(r.imag()) == std::signbit(x[i].imag())); 48 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) 52 assert(std::isinf(r.imag())); 53 assert(std::signbit(x[i].imag()) == std::signbit(r.imag())); 55 else if ( x[i].real() == 0 && std::isnan(x[i].imag())) 59 assert(std::isnan(r.imag())); 61 else if (std::isfinite(x[i].real()) && std::isnan(x[i].imag())) [all...] |
exp.pass.cpp | 41 if (x[i].real() == 0 && x[i].imag() == 0) 44 assert(r.imag() == 0); 45 assert(std::signbit(x[i].imag()) == std::signbit(r.imag())); 47 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) 50 assert(std::isnan(r.imag())); 52 else if (std::isfinite(x[i].real()) && std::isnan(x[i].imag())) 55 assert(std::isnan(r.imag())); 57 else if (std::isinf(x[i].real()) && x[i].real() > 0 && x[i].imag() == 0) 61 assert(r.imag() == 0) [all...] |
asinh.pass.cpp | 43 if (x[i].real() == 0 && x[i].imag() == 0) 46 assert(std::signbit(r.imag()) == std::signbit(x[i].imag())); 48 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) 52 if (std::signbit(x[i].imag())) 53 is_about(r.imag(), -pi/2); 55 is_about(r.imag(), pi/2); 57 else if (std::isfinite(x[i].real()) && std::isnan(x[i].imag())) 60 assert(std::isnan(r.imag())); 62 else if (std::isinf(x[i].real()) && std::isfinite(x[i].imag())) [all...] |
cosh.pass.cpp | 43 if (x[i].real() == 0 && x[i].imag() == 0) 46 assert(r.imag() == 0); 47 assert(std::signbit(r.imag()) == std::signbit(x[i].imag())); 49 else if (x[i].real() == 0 && std::isinf(x[i].imag())) 52 assert(r.imag() == 0); 54 else if (x[i].real() == 0 && std::isnan(x[i].imag())) 57 assert(r.imag() == 0); 59 else if (std::isfinite(x[i].real()) && std::isinf(x[i].imag())) 62 assert(std::isnan(r.imag())); [all...] |
sqrt.pass.cpp | 27 assert(std::abs(imag(c)) < 1.e-6); 43 if (x[i].real() == 0 && x[i].imag() == 0) 46 assert(std::signbit(r.imag()) == std::signbit(x[i].imag())); 48 else if (std::isinf(x[i].imag())) 52 assert(std::isinf(r.imag())); 53 assert(std::signbit(r.imag()) == std::signbit(x[i].imag())); 55 else if (std::isfinite(x[i].real()) && std::isnan(x[i].imag())) 58 assert(std::isnan(r.imag())); [all...] |
/prebuilts/misc/common/swig/include/2.0.11/octave/ |
octcomplex.swg | 4 the complex Constructor method, and the Real and Imag complex 11 %define %swig_fromcplx_conv(Type, OctConstructor, Real, Imag) 17 return octave_value(OctConstructor(Real(c), Imag(c))); 23 %define %swig_cplxdbl_conv(Type, Constructor, Real, Imag) 33 *val=Constructor(c.real(),c.imag()); 48 %swig_fromcplx_conv(Type, Complex, Real, Imag); 52 %define %swig_cplxflt_conv(Type, Constructor, Real, Imag) 62 double im = c.imag(); 84 %swig_fromcplx_conv(Type, FloatComplex, Real, Imag); 87 #define %swig_cplxflt_convn(Type, Constructor, Real, Imag) \ [all...] |
/external/chromium_org/third_party/openmax_dl/dl/sp/src/x86/ |
x86SP_SSE_Math.h | 31 * in real and corresponding imaginary parts in imag. 35 __m128 imag; member in struct:VComplex 41 _mm_mul_ps(a->imag, b->imag)); 42 out->imag = _mm_add_ps(_mm_mul_ps(a->real, b->imag), 43 _mm_mul_ps(a->imag, b->real)); 49 _mm_mul_ps(a->imag, b->imag)); 50 out->imag = _mm_sub_ps(_mm_mul_ps(a->real, b->imag) [all...] |
/prebuilts/misc/common/swig/include/2.0.11/python/ |
pycomplex.swg | 4 the complex Constructor method, and the Real and Imag complex 11 %define %swig_fromcplx_conv(Type, Real, Imag) 17 return PyComplex_FromDoubles(Real(c), Imag(c)); 23 %define %swig_cplxdbl_conv(Type, Constructor, Real, Imag) 44 %swig_fromcplx_conv(Type, Real, Imag); 48 %define %swig_cplxflt_conv(Type, Constructor, Real, Imag) 76 %swig_fromcplx_conv(Type, Real, Imag); 79 #define %swig_cplxflt_convn(Type, Constructor, Real, Imag) \ 80 %swig_cplxflt_conv(Type, Constructor, Real, Imag) 83 #define %swig_cplxdbl_convn(Type, Constructor, Real, Imag) \ [all...] |
/prebuilts/misc/common/swig/include/2.0.11/ruby/ |
rubycomplex.swg | 4 the complex Constructor method, and the Real and Imag complex 27 static ID imag_id = rb_intern("imag"); 43 static ID imag_id = rb_intern("imag"); 55 %define %swig_fromcplx_conv(Type, Real, Imag) 62 VALUE im = rb_float_new(Imag(c)); 69 %define %swig_cplxdbl_conv(Type, Constructor, Real, Imag) 80 VALUE imag = SWIG_Complex_Imaginary(o); 84 SWIG_AsVal_double( imag, &im ); 99 %swig_fromcplx_conv(Type, Real, Imag); 103 %define %swig_cplxflt_conv(Type, Constructor, Real, Imag) [all...] |
/external/libcxx/test/numerics/complex.number/complex.members/ |
real_imag.pass.cpp | 13 // void imag(T val); 25 static_assert(c1.imag() == 0, ""); 28 static_assert(c2.imag() == 0, ""); 31 static_assert(c3.imag() == 4, ""); 41 assert(c.imag() == 0); 44 assert(c.imag() == 0); 45 c.imag(4.5); 47 assert(c.imag() == 4.5); 50 assert(c.imag() == 4.5); 51 c.imag(-5.5) [all...] |